PHILIPPINE Christian University and University of Perpetual Help Dalta System fashioned out constrasting victories at the start of 2nd Philippine University Basketball League (PUBL) at TUP gym in Manila.

NPCU downed Mapua University, 70-57, while UPHDS defeated Technological University of the Philippines, 68-63, to take the headstart in this six-team tournament organized by the Federation of School Sports Association of the Philippines (FESSAP) in cooperation with the Asia Pacific University Sports Union (APUSU) and Basketball Association of the Philippines (BAP).

FESSAP president Edwin Fabro made the ceremonial toss along with TUP president Engr. Reynaldo P. Ramos.

Ramos also made the opening remarks

Handled by former PBA standout Biboy Simon, the Dolphins leaned on the 1-2 punch of Lionel Failon and John Lloyd Balvarin in beating the Cardinals.

Failon finished with 20 points while Balvarin added 13 points.

Resty Fornis and Clint Escamis combined for 29 points for Mapua ,which was handled by assistant coaches Nani Epondulan and Lito Aguilar.

The Altas of coach Mike Saguiguit and assistant coach Stephen Mopera rode on Cyrus Nitura, Jericho Nunez Gelo Gelsano and Joey Barcuna to roll back the Grayhawks.

Nitura fired 21 points, followed by Nunez and Gelsano with 14 points apiece and Barcuna with 11 points for the Las Piñas-based school.

Carl Bringas and David Magbanua lead TUP with 24 and 16 points, respectively.

Also present during the short but colorful opening ceremony are TUP sports director Allan Soria, AIMS sports director Norman Pangilinan, Mapua sports director Melchor Divina and PCU athletic director Martha Beata Ijiran.

In the first game, Bataan Peninsula State University crushed Asian Institute of Maritime Studies, 76-63.

..John Carlos Valerio, Janzel Red Gatdula and Joemar Tolentino scored in double figures for the Stallions of coach Randy Rodriguez and sports director Romeo Nisay.

Valerio topscored with 19 points followed by Gatdula with 16 and Tolentino added 10 points.
